(C) During a pull-aside at a commercial-diplomatic event in Astana on October 31, Austrian Ambassador Ursula Fahringer asked if the United States has any current information on the whereabouts of the former Kazakhstani Ambassador to Austria and President Nazarbayev's ex-son-in-law, Rakhat Aliyev, who has been convicted in absentia of "serious crimes" in Kazakhstan. She said the to-date presence of Aliyev in Austria has poisoned Austrian-Kazakhstani relations. Vienna has lost track of Aliyev but presumes he will try to stay within the Shengen visa area. The Ambassador responded that Aliyev is not high priority for the United States, despite requests to us from the government of Kazakhstan to help find Aliyev and return him to Kazakhstan. He said he is unaware from any source of Aliyev's current whereabouts. ¶2. (C) Ambasador Fahringer asked if the United States would extradite Aliyev from the United States, should he turn up there. The Ambassador responded that Aliyev's legal entry into the United States woukd be unlikely, if for no other reason than his Interpol listing. He noted the United States does not have an extradition treaty with Kazakhstan, and so extradition would not necessarily be assured. ¶3. (C) Ambassador Fahringer, admitting she was not under instructions, asked if the United States would pass fullest information to Vienna about Aliyev. The Ambassador responded he would convey this request to Washington. He suggested it might be better for the Government of Austria to deal with this issue either in Washington or at the U.S. Embassy in Vienna. HOAGLAND
